Under the direct supervision of the HME Manager, the HME Customer Service Representative is responsible for supporting daily front office operations and assisting customers in a retail store. This role serves as a key point of contact for patients, caregivers, and referral sources—managing equipment orders, retail sales, insurance verification, and product education to ensure an excellent customer experience.
Responsibilities
Essential Job Functions:
- Greet and assist customers in person and via phone with professionalism and empathy
- Process equipment and supply orders accurately and in a timely manner
- Verify insurance eligibility and obtain prior authorizations when necessary
- Communicate with referral sources, including physicians and case managers, to coordinate services
- Schedule delivery, setup, or pickup of equipment with patients and the delivery team
- Maintain patient records and documentation in compliance with HIPAA and company policy
- Assist in resolving customer complaints or concerns and escalate issues as needed
- Collaborate with billing staff to ensure accurate and timely claims processing
- Perform general office duties including filing, data entry, and inventory coordination
- Stay informed of industry regulations and payer requirements affecting HME services
- Welcome and assist walk-in retail customers in selecting appropriate medical products
- Provide education on use, care, and features of home medical equipment and supplies
- Operate the point-of-sale (POS) system to process sales transactions accurately
- Maintain clean, organized, and well-stocked retail displays and inventory
- Assist with restocking, inventory checks, and placing supply orders
- Promote new products and special offers to increase sales and customer engagement
- Handle product returns and exchanges in accordance with store policy and regulatory guidelines
- Stay current on HME product lines, recalls, and safety information
